The Virtual University of Pakistan (VU) was established by the Government of Pakistan in 2002 as a public sector university. It pioneered the concept of distance learning in the country, utilizing modern information and communication technologies to provide world-class education at the doorstep.
VU has a massive footprint across Pakistan and abroad, offering extremely affordable yet high-quality education. It is recognized by the Higher Education Commission (HEC) and is famous for its rigorous academic standards and advanced Learning Management System (LMS).

Calculating your semester result at Virtual University is simple. Just follow these steps.
Check your LMS for course marks and matching letter grades (e.g., A, B-).
Assign grade points to each grade using the VU chart (A = 4.0, A- = 3.66).
Add up "Quality Points" and divide by total semester credits.
VU uses a refined grading system to ensure fair evaluation. View the scale below.
| Marks (%) | Letter Grade | Grade Points |
|---|---|---|
| 85 - 100 | A | 4.00 |
| 80 - 84 | A- | 3.66 |
| 75 - 79 | B+ | 3.33 |
| 71 - 74 | B | 3.00 |
| 68 - 70 | B- | 2.66 |
| 61 - 67 | C | 2.00 |
| 50 - 60 | D | 1.00 |
| Below 50 | F | 0.00 |

Students usually need at least 50% overall marks (D grade) and must pass both sessional and final term exams with minimum marks as per current HEC and VU rules.
